The WordPress Exploit July 2026, widely known as WP2Shell, has quickly become one of the most significant cybersecurity events affecting the WordPress ecosystem in recent years. Unlike the majority of WordPress attacks that target vulnerable plugins or themes, WP2Shell affects WordPress Core itself, putting millions of websites at potential risk.
The attack combines two vulnerabilities—CVE-2026-63030 and CVE-2026-60137—into a single exploit chain capable of achieving unauthenticated Remote Code Execution (RCE). In simple terms, a successful attack could allow a malicious actor to execute code on a vulnerable server without needing to log in first.
Security researchers reported widespread Internet scanning shortly after the vulnerabilities were disclosed, highlighting how quickly attackers move to exploit newly discovered security flaws. In response, the WordPress Security Team released emergency security updates and enabled automatic security updates for supported installations, helping protect millions of websites worldwide.

What is WP2Shell?
WP2Shell is the name given to an exploit chain that combines two separate WordPress Core vulnerabilities:
- CVE-2026-63030 – A critical REST API vulnerability with a CVSS score of 9.8 (Critical).
- CVE-2026-60137 – A SQL Injection vulnerability with a CVSS score of 5.9 (Medium).
On their own, both vulnerabilities present security risks. However, modern cyberattacks rarely rely on a single weakness. Instead, attackers often chain multiple vulnerabilities together, allowing one flaw to open the door for another. WP2Shell is an example of this technique.
The REST API vulnerability allows specially crafted requests to reach functionality that should normally be inaccessible. Combined with the SQL Injection vulnerability, attackers may be able to execute arbitrary code on the server, potentially gaining complete control over the affected website.
Why This Exploit Is Different
WordPress security advisories commonly involve third-party plugins or themes, where only websites using a specific extension are affected. WP2Shell is different because it impacts WordPress Core itself, making the potential attack surface much larger.
Security researchers have also described WP2Shell as the first critical unauthenticated Remote Code Execution vulnerability affecting WordPress Core in nearly a decade. Unlike many previous vulnerabilities, attackers do not need administrator credentials or a compromised user account to begin the attack.
Another important factor is the speed at which attackers responded. Shortly after public disclosure, security companies reported automated Internet-wide scanning for vulnerable websites. This demonstrates how quickly newly disclosed vulnerabilities can become active targets and reinforces the importance of installing security updates as soon as they become available.
Who Is Affected?
The affected versions include:
- WordPress 6.8.0 – 6.8.5
- WordPress 6.9.0 – 6.9.4
- WordPress 7.0.0 – 7.0.1

How to Protect Your Website
The most effective way to protect your website is to update WordPress immediately to a patched version. Installing the official security update removes the vulnerable code and closes the attack path used by WP2Shell.
If updating immediately is not possible—for example, due to compatibility testing or business requirements—you should implement temporary security measures to reduce your exposure until the update can be installed.
Recommended security practices include:
- Restrict public access to the WordPress REST API where possible.
- Keep trusted security plugins active and up to date.
- Remove unused themes and plugins.
- Ensure automatic WordPress security updates are enabled.
- Maintain regular backups that can be restored if your website becomes compromised.
Don’t Stop After Updating
Installing the latest WordPress version closes the vulnerability, but it does not automatically remove malware or unauthorized changes if attackers successfully exploited your website before it was patched.
If a compromise occurred, attackers may have created administrator accounts, uploaded malicious PHP files, installed web shells, modified plugins or themes, or established other methods of maintaining access to the website. Simply updating WordPress will not remove these changes.
After applying the security update, website administrators should perform a basic security review by:
- Checking for unknown administrator accounts.
- Reviewing recently modified files.
- Looking for suspicious PHP files, particularly inside upload directories.
- Running a malware scan using a trusted security solution.
- Changing administrator passwords if compromise is suspected.
- Restoring from a clean backup if malicious modifications are discovered.
